What is Endurance?

Endurance is a growth-oriented Russian-American technological

start-up, specializing on development and bringing on the

market affordable, open – source robotics technologies for

educators: schools, colleges and STEM centers.

Endurance provides teachers and students with the tools and

resources to learn about robots and their applications in “hands

on” environments, and offers a framework for students.

A fully robotized open - source

software platform: face and voice

recognition and voice synthesis A real open – source software

platform than can be used for any

robotics project

Microsoft SAPI for voice synthesis

OpenCV library for face detection and

face recognition

Google Speech API for voice

recognition

Working and tested for Windows 8 /

10 (good for tablets)

Can be used in a variety of robotics

programs like: digital receptionist,

robotics meeter greeter, shop assistant
